Autonomy level is a first-class entity attribute describing how much decision authority an autonomous system holds.
| Level | Name | Human role |
|---|---|---|
| 0 | manual |
Full human control |
| 1 | assisted |
Driver/operator assistance |
| 2 | partial_automation |
Human monitors automation |
| 3 | conditional_autonomy |
System drives within ODD; human fallback |
| 4 | high_autonomy |
System drives within ODD; human not required |
| 5 | full_autonomy |
No human intervention expected |
Autonomy level affects governance validation for:
| Domain | Influence |
|---|---|
| Decision authority | Max level capped by deployment profile |
| Recovery | Higher autonomy requires automated recovery policies |
| Human approval | Levels 0–3 require responsible person |
| Safety validation | Level 3+ requires trusted entity posture |
| Trust | Minimum trust tier escalates with level |
| Mission planning | Approval workflows scale with level |
| Readiness | High autonomy missions require readiness gates |

CLI and API accept flexible aliases: level_3, l3, 3, conditional, conditional_autonomy.
Each deployment profile sets max_autonomy_level. Governance validation warns when entity autonomy
exceeds the profile maximum.
